Incorporating Edible Elements
A growing trend in 2025 is the inclusion of edible elements like fruits and vegetables in floral arrangements. This adds texture, color, and a unique twist to traditional florals, creating a feast for both the eyes and the palate.
How to Use at The Farm at River's Edge:
- Centerpieces: Combine seasonal fruits such as grapes or berries with flowers to create lush and abundant centerpieces that reflect the bounty of summer.
- Decorative Displays: Utilize decorative vegetables like artichokes or kale within your arrangements to add unexpected texture and intrigue.

How can I ensure my floral arrangements withstand the summer heat at The Farm at River's Edge?
Opt for hardy blooms known for their resilience in warmer temperatures, such as dahlias, sunflowers, and zinnias. Additionally, work with your florist to ensure proper hydration and consider timing the setup to minimize exposure to direct sunlight before the event.
